A first-half double-double from Armando Bacot and a season-high 16 points from Jae’Lyn Withers helped No. 1 Carolina breeze past No. 16 seed Wagner in the opening round of the NCAA Tournament Thursday afternoon in Charlotte. Bacot finished with 20 points and 15 rebounds. At halftime, he’d already accumulated 14 points and 11 rebounds against the undersized Seahawks. Withers, a Charlotte native, showed out in front of his hometown, grabbing 10 rebounds in addition to his 16 points to register his second double-double of the season. R.J. Davis scored 22 points and Cormac Ryan added 13. UNC now holds a 32-2 all-time record in the NCAA Tournament’s Round of 64. The Tar Heels will face No. 9 seed Michigan State in the Round of 32 on Saturday.
